There are 1,006 schools with worse air toxic ranks than this school nationwide.
This school's air toxic concentration is 15.29 times the national average at schools.
There are 327 schools with worse air toxic ranks than this school statewide.
This school's air toxic concentration is 6.76 times the state average at schools.
